To identity the alert extensions to ring when the doorphone button is pressed or
when the internal hotline phone’s handset is picked up, or to store the outside
number to be dialed when the external hotline phone’s handset is picked up,
follow these steps from extension 10:
1.
Press [
Feature
] [
0
] [
0
].
2.
Press left [
Intercom
] twice.
3.
Press right [
Intercom
].
4. Dial the two-digit extension number assigned to the doorphone, internal
hotline phone, or external hotline phone.
5.
Press the leftmost programmable Auto Dial button on the upper row of Auto
Dial buttons.
6.
To identify alert extensions or store an outside phone number:
To identify a single alert extension, press left [ Intercom ] and the two-digit
extension number.
To indicate that all extensions are to be alert extensions, press left
[
Intercom
] and [
7
].
To store an outside number for an external hotline phone, dial the
phone number (up to 20 digits). For example, to store 555-2398, press
[
5
] [
5
] [
5
] [
2
] [
3
] [
9
] [
8
].
7.
To identify alert extensions or to store an outside number for a different
extension, begin again at Step 3.
8.
When you are finished, press [
Feature
] [
0
] [
0
].
